1. Using the Apple TV Website
One of the easiest ways to watch Apple TV on your PC is via the Apple TV website. This method does not require any additional downloads, making it user-friendly.
Steps to Watch Apple TV via the Website
- Open your preferred web browser on your PC.
- Visit the Apple TV website by navigating to tv.apple.com.
- Sign in using your Apple ID and password. If you don’t have an Apple ID, you will need to create one.
- Browse through available content, or search for specific shows or movies.
- Click on the title you would like to watch and hit the play button.
This method is convenient and allows easy access to all your favorite Apple TV content from your PC. Ensure you have a stable internet connection to maintain quality streaming.

Essential Requirements for Streaming Apple TV Content
While accessing Apple TV through the web or iTunes is relatively straightforward, you need to meet certain requirements to ensure a seamless viewing experience.
System Requirements
For optimal performance, ensure your PC meets the following requirements:
- Operating System: Windows 10 or later recommended.
- Browser: Latest version of Chrome, Firefox, Safari, or Microsoft Edge.
- Internet Connection: A stable broadband connection of at least 5 Mbps.
- Apple ID: Active Apple ID for signing in to access content.
Browser Compatibility
It’s important to use a supported and updated web browser when accessing Apple TV online. Some older versions may not support all features, diminishing the overall experience. Always check for updates or consider switching to a more compatible browser.

Are there any issues to be aware of when using Apple TV on my PC?
When using Apple TV on your PC, you may encounter certain issues that can affect your viewing experience. One common problem is buffering or poor streaming quality, which is usually due to an unstable internet connection. Make sure to check your Wi-Fi signal strength and consider using a wired Ethernet connection for better performance.
Another potential issue is browser compatibility. While most modern browsers support streaming, some settings or extensions can disrupt playback. It’s advisable to disable any ad blockers or privacy extensions and ensure that your browser is up to date for the best results. Regularly clearing cache and cookies can also help improve streaming performance.
